Construction Trades is one of the most popular subjects to study in Pennsylvania. With 1,635 degrees and certificates handed out in 2021-2022, it ranked 5th out of all the majors we track in the state.

This report analyzed 23 schools in Pennsylvania to see which ones were the most popular associate degree programs for trade school students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Construction Trades program at each school on the list.
